Doritos F1 Head2Head Combines Two Flavors in One Bag

Inspired by the competitive spirit of Formula 1 racing, Doritos F1 Head2Head is a new, limited-time snack that pits two flavors against one another—one returning, one brand-new. With two flavors in one bag, snackers get to decide which of the two is their favorite, from savory Late Night Loaded Taco and the all-new bright, zesty and spiced Chimichurri Lime. The limited-time launch comes in race-inspired packaging, highlighting the brand's official partnership with Formula 1.

Fan-fueled flavor competitions are a reliable way for brands to drive up engagement, tapping into consumers' love of playful debates, ranking and picking sides. With the Doritos F1 Head2Head format, available at participating retailers nationwide while supplies last, Doritos naturally invites side-by-side chip taste tests and shareable social media content that centers on the same.
